#d964d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d964d0 is composed of 85.1% red, 39.2%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.9% magenta, 4.1%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 304.6 degrees, a saturation of 60.6% and a lightness of 62.2%. #d964d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#b300a1.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#d964d0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fcf2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d964d0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a598a4 is the less saturated color, while #fe3fef is the most saturated one.
